3. Setup and Installation
Follow these steps to correctly install the replacement chisel into your NEWTRY C6 Pneumatic Hammer:
- Ensure the pneumatic hammer is disconnected from the air compressor.
- Insert the chisel into the hammer's chuck.
- Secure the chisel with the quick-change retainer spring mechanism. Ensure it is firmly seated and cannot be easily pulled out.
- Connect the pneumatic hammer to the air compressor.
- Before operating, perform a quick check to ensure the chisel is securely installed.

5. Maintenance
Proper maintenance ensures the longevity and optimal performance of your chisel:
- Cleaning: After each use, clean the chisel to remove any debris, rust, or material residue. Use a wire brush if necessary.
- Lubrication: Apply a light coat of oil to the chisel shank and tip to prevent rust and ensure smooth operation within the hammer's chuck.
- Inspection: Regularly inspect the chisel for signs of wear, cracks, or damage. Replace the chisel if it shows significant wear or damage to prevent potential hazards or reduced performance.
- Storage: Store the chisel in a dry place to prevent corrosion.
6. Safety Information
Always observe the following safety precautions when using the chisel with a pneumatic hammer:
- Personal Protective Equipment (PPE): Always wear safety glasses or goggles, hearing protection, and appropriate gloves. Consider a dust mask if working with materials that produce fine particles.
- Tool Condition: Before each use, inspect both the chisel and the pneumatic hammer for any damage or loose parts. Do not use damaged equipment.
- Secure Workpiece: Ensure your workpiece is stable and securely clamped to prevent movement during operation.
- Proper Grip: Maintain a firm grip on the pneumatic hammer.
- Air Pressure: Operate the pneumatic hammer within the manufacturer's recommended air pressure range.
- Disconnect Air Supply: Always disconnect the air supply before changing chisels, performing maintenance, or when the tool is not in use.
- Clear Area: Keep bystanders and pets away from the work area. Be aware of flying debris.

8. Troubleshooting
- Chisel does not fit: Ensure you are using the correct model (NEWTRY C6 Pneumatic Hammer). Check for any obstructions in the hammer's chuck.
- Reduced performance: Inspect the chisel tip for excessive wear or damage. Ensure the chisel is securely seated in the hammer. Verify adequate air pressure from the compressor.
- Chisel gets stuck: Ensure proper lubrication of the chisel shank. Avoid excessive force or improper angles during operation.
